Hair Anatomy and Physiology from Ancestral Views
Textured hair, with its remarkable coils, curls, and waves, possesses a distinct anatomical blueprint. The unique shape of its follicle—often oval or elliptical rather than round—dictates the curl pattern, causing the hair shaft to grow in an angled, helical manner. This structural peculiarity, though responsible for its visual splendor, also means that natural oils, known as sebum, struggle to travel down the winding shaft, leaving textured hair more prone to dryness. This inherent characteristic was, undoubtedly, an observation made by ancestors who lived intimately with their hair, noticing its thirst and devising remedies that spoke directly to this need.
The wisdom of oiling the scalp and strands, a practice prevalent across various ancestral communities, directly counters this biological reality. Ancient Egyptians, for instance, used castor and olive oils to cleanse and condition hair, ensuring moisture and promoting hair health.

Protective Styling Encyclopedia and Ancestral Roots
Protective styles, a cornerstone of textured hair care today, are far from a modern invention. These styles, which tuck away fragile ends and minimize manipulation, have ancestral roots stretching back thousands of years across Africa and the Black diaspora. From the intricate cornrows depicted on ancient Egyptian carvings to the majestic braids of various West African tribes, these styles served multiple purposes.
They signaled tribal affiliation, social status, marital availability, and spiritual beliefs. Beyond their symbolic weight, they were highly practical, shielding hair from environmental damage, retaining moisture, and promoting growth.
The very concept of a protective style demonstrates an empirical understanding of hair mechanics. Ancestors understood that constant exposure to harsh elements—sun, dust, friction—damaged hair. By securing hair in braids or twists, they intuitively minimized breakage points and allowed the hair to rest and flourish.
Modern trichology confirms this, showing that reduced manipulation and environmental exposure directly correlate with stronger, longer hair. The longevity of these styles, often worn for weeks, allowed for minimal daily intervention, a practice that reduces mechanical stress on the hair shaft.
Consider the enduring legacy of Ghana Braids, also known as cornrows. These styles, where hair is braided close to the scalp in continuous, raised rows, have been worn for millennia. Their heritage spans across various African communities, from the ancient Nok civilization to contemporary urban centers.
The tight yet flexible tension of the cornrow protects the scalp and hair shaft from external aggressors, distributing tension evenly across many follicles rather than concentrating it on a few. This meticulous approach to securing the hair reflects an ancestral knowledge of preserving fragile textured strands.

Natural Styling and Definition Techniques
The art of natural styling, which seeks to define and enhance textured hair’s inherent curl pattern, draws heavily from ancient wisdom. Before chemical treatments or heat styling became widespread, communities across the globe used natural ingredients and gentle techniques to celebrate their hair’s natural form. The search for definition and luster led to the discovery of plant-based mucilages, botanical gels, and rich oils that provided hold and shine without harsh intervention.
Does the science of hair definition validate ancestral methods?
Indeed. For example, the use of flaxseed gel, a popular natural styling agent today, creates a light hold by forming a flexible film on the hair shaft. This film helps to clump curls, reducing frizz and enhancing definition. While the science behind this involves polysaccharides binding to keratin, ancestral communities likely discovered this through trial and error, recognizing the tangible benefits of such plant extracts.
Similarly, the use of rich plant butters, like Shea Butter, for sealing moisture and adding weight to curls, was an ancient practice. Research now shows Shea butter’s high fatty acid content, including oleic and stearic acids, allows it to effectively prevent water loss and protect the hair shaft. This ancestral application intuitively understood the emollient properties that modern science later elucidated.

Wigs and Hair Extensions Mastery through History
The history of wigs and hair extensions in Black and mixed-race communities is extensive, reaching back to ancient civilizations. These were not merely fashion statements but carried significant cultural, social, and practical meanings. Ancient Egyptians, for instance, used wigs made from human hair, plant fibers, and even animal hair.
These were often adorned and styled with great care, protected with beeswax and animal fats, and worn by people of all genders and social classes. Wigs served practical purposes too, offering protection from the harsh sun and acting as a barrier against lice.

Heat Styling and Thermal Reconditioning ❉ A Look Back
While modern heat styling tools offer unprecedented control, the concept of altering hair texture with heat has a historical precedent, though with considerably different methods. In the early 20th century, the hot comb became a widespread tool for straightening textured hair, particularly for Black women. This tool, while offering a temporary alteration, also came with risks of scalp burns and heat damage, contrasting sharply with the nourishing, protective intent of earlier ancestral methods.
The ancestral approach to hair care prioritized the inherent health and vitality of the strand, often favoring techniques that preserved its natural state over those that forced a temporary alteration. This historical divergence highlights a crucial point ❉ the validation of ancient wisdom often lies in its gentle, sustainable practices that work with the hair’s natural properties, rather than against them. Modern science confirms that excessive heat exposure can denature keratin proteins and damage the cuticle, leading to irreversible structural compromise. This knowledge underscores the protective wisdom embedded in traditional, non-heat-reliant styling.

How do traditional regimens align with modern hair science?
Modern science confirms the necessity of a tailored approach for textured hair, recognizing its varied porosity, density, and curl patterns. Audrey Davis-Sivasothy, in her book, “The Science of Black Hair ❉ A Comprehensive Guide to Textured Hair Care,” extensively details how a balanced protein/moisture strategy is key to preventing breakage, a phenomenon well-understood empirically by ancestral communities who sought to preserve hair length. The practices of deep conditioning with ingredients like avocado or plantain, or sealing moisture with specific butters, directly align with modern understandings of humectancy and emollients. Ancestors, through trial and error, discovered which plant compounds served as effective humectants, drawing moisture from the air, or as emollients, smoothing the cuticle and sealing in hydration.
The generational application of natural remedies for textured hair, though lacking modern scientific labels, consistently addressed core hair needs like moisture retention and cuticle health.
For instance, the use of a variety of oils in traditional hair care, from coconut oil to olive oil, finds scientific backing in their differing molecular structures and fatty acid compositions. Coconut oil, with its high lauric acid content, has a unique ability to penetrate the hair shaft, reducing protein loss during washing. This penetrating power was likely observed and utilized long before electron microscopes confirmed its molecular journey into the hair’s cortex.
Similarly, olive oil, rich in monounsaturated fats and antioxidants, nourishes the scalp and helps prevent dryness. The wisdom of combining or layering these oils suggests an intuitive formulary, optimizing for different needs.

The Nighttime Sanctuary ❉ Essential Sleep Protection and Bonnet Wisdom
The ritual of nighttime hair protection is a testament to ancestral ingenuity and a clear example of science validating ancient care wisdom. Long before satin bonnets became a retail staple, various African and diasporic communities understood the importance of protecting hair during sleep. Wrapping hair in soft cloths or scarves was a common practice. This was not merely about preserving a style; it was about protecting the integrity of the hair shaft from friction, tangling, and moisture loss.
The science here is straightforward ❉ cotton pillowcases absorb moisture from hair, leaving it dry and susceptible to breakage. The friction generated between hair and a coarse surface like cotton also leads to cuticle damage, snags, and knots. Silk and satin, with their smooth surfaces, reduce this friction significantly, allowing hair to glide without resistance. This preserves the delicate outer cuticle layer, minimizes tangling, and helps retain essential moisture.
A direct historical parallel is the use of smooth, woven fabrics, or even animal skins, by various African groups to wrap their hair before rest, demonstrating an innate understanding of this protective principle. The widespread adoption of the satin bonnet today is a direct descendant of this ancestral foresight.

Ingredient Deep Dives for Textured Hair Needs
The ancestral pharmacy for textured hair was vast, drawing from a profound knowledge of local flora and natural substances. Many of these traditional ingredients, now categorized as “natural” or “botanical,” are being rigorously studied, revealing the chemical compounds responsible for their long-observed benefits.
One powerful instance is the ancestral use of Fenugreek (Trigonella Foenum-Graecum). Across South Asian and North African traditions, fenugreek seeds were soaked, ground, and applied as a paste or rinse for hair and scalp health. This practice was believed to reduce hair fall and promote growth. Modern scientific investigation supports this.
Fenugreek seeds contain a rich array of proteins, nicotinic acid, and lecithin. Lecithin, a natural emollient, aids in strengthening hair, while nicotinic acid and proteins are vital for healthy hair roots. These components contribute to its traditional benefits for hair strength and shine. A specific study on African hair showed that Crambe Abyssinica seed oil (ASO), rich in C22 unsaturated fatty acid triglycerides, offered concrete benefits, including maintaining cortex strength and protecting from solar radiation. This demonstrates how traditional plant-based oils carry demonstrable biochemical properties beneficial to textured hair.
Another powerful example is the ancient use of Aloe Vera (Aloe Barbadensis Miller). Across various indigenous cultures, aloe vera gel was applied directly to the scalp and hair for its soothing and moisturizing properties. Science now confirms aloe vera contains proteolytic enzymes that repair dead skin cells on the scalp, acting as a great conditioner and leaving hair smooth and shiny.
Its slightly alkaline nature can help to balance scalp pH, and its anti-inflammatory properties can calm irritation. This traditional use directly correlates with its modern biochemical profile.
Traditional Hair Ingredients and Their Biochemical Rationale:
- Amla (Indian Gooseberry) ❉ Rich in Vitamin C, which is essential for collagen synthesis, a key protein for hair structure. Also contains antioxidants.
- Shikakai (Acacia Concinna) ❉ Contains natural saponins, offering gentle cleansing without stripping natural oils. Its low pH helps maintain the scalp’s protective layer.
- Reetha (Soap Nut) ❉ Another source of natural saponins, used for mild cleansing.
- Neem (Azadirachta Indica) ❉ Known for its antibacterial and antifungal properties, beneficial for scalp health.

Textured Hair Problem Solving Compendium
Ancestral communities addressed hair challenges with a deep well of knowledge, often rooted in an understanding of underlying systemic imbalances rather than isolated symptoms. Issues like dryness, breakage, and scalp irritation were met with holistic interventions that combined external applications with internal wellness.
For instance, ancestral approaches to severe dryness often involved consistent oiling regimens, deep conditioning with plant masks, and protective styling. Modern science supports these strategies by confirming that oils seal moisture and reduce hygral fatigue, the damage caused by repeated swelling and shrinking of the hair shaft from water absorption and evaporation. The anti-inflammatory properties of ingredients like shea butter are also now understood to alleviate scalp irritation, which can contribute to hair loss.
The historical context of hair loss remedies also provides fascinating intersections. Ancient Egyptian texts, such as the Ebers Papyrus, document remedies for baldness, often involving various oils and plant extracts. While the efficacy of all these ancient remedies is still being explored, their very existence speaks to a long-standing human concern for hair retention and a persistent effort to understand its biology. Holistic Influences on Hair Health
The profoundest validation of ancient care wisdom lies in its holistic philosophy ❉ the understanding that hair health is inseparable from overall well-being. Ancestral wellness philosophies, such as Ayurveda in India, viewed hair care as an integral part of a balanced life, encompassing diet, stress management, and spiritual harmony. This contrasts with a more compartmentalized modern approach that sometimes separates hair care from total body health.
This holistic approach is increasingly being recognized by modern science. Research links stress to hair loss, nutritional deficiencies to poor hair quality, and overall inflammation to scalp conditions. The ancient practice of scalp massage, for example, known as Champi in Ayurvedic tradition, was not just for relaxation. Studies now show that regular scalp massage significantly increases blood flow to hair follicles, providing more oxygen and nutrients crucial for growth.
This ancestral practice, seen as a component of holistic well-being, directly impacts the biological mechanisms of hair growth.
